Carl Johann Schroeder is a spiritual teacher and life coach and calls his system for person evolution Inner Selves Mastery. He offers frequent meetings and classes, hosts a YouTube channel, and is committed to helping people discover how good our life can be and how Heaven on the Earth is well within our destiny.

Summary In this conversation, Carl and Sage explore profound themes of love, truth, and usefulness as essential elements of life. They discuss personal journeys, the importance of inner responsibility, and the dynamics of spirituality in navigating the material world. The dialogue emphasizes the significance of self-acceptance, the management of negativity, and the power of personal experience in shaping one's reality. Ultimately, they reflect on the interconnectedness of these themes and the journey of personal growth.
